Sherborne School

Doha

The campus has been organised around the needs of the prep and senior schools and an ingenious solution to segregate movement for male and female pupils. Other unique features include a standalone sports complex and an innovative STEM (Science, Technology, Engineering, Maths) and learning zone.
A bespoke and robust environmental strategy was also developed to meet the extreme demands of the climate including orientating the buildings to exploit the direction of the prevailing wind, using the cooling effect of the ground to condition air through the use of an underground labyrinth and exploiting strategic placement of trees for their evaporative cooling properties.
